Understanding the Crankshaft's Role in Your Hyundai Engine

The crankshaft's primary function is to convert the up-and-down (reciprocating) motion of the pistons into a rotational motion that powers the wheels. Think of it like this: the pistons, driven by combustion, push down on the connecting rods. These rods are attached to the crankshaft, causing it to rotate. This rotation is then transmitted through the drivetrain – including the transmission and axles – to the wheels, propelling your Hyundai forward. A crankshaft designed for a Hyundai VVT 1.6 engine must be precisely balanced and manufactured to exacting specifications to handle the high stresses and vibrations inherent in internal combustion. Potential Issues and Symptoms of a Failing Crankshaft

A failing crankshaft can manifest in several ways, and recognizing these symptoms early can potentially prevent further damage to your engine. One of the most common signs is a noticeable knocking or rattling noise coming from the engine, especially during acceleration or when the engine is under load. This noise can be caused by worn crankshaft bearings, which create excessive play between the crankshaft and the connecting rods. Another symptom is increased engine vibration, which you might feel through the steering wheel or the seats. This vibration can be a result of an unbalanced crankshaft. Furthermore, you might experience a loss of engine power, reduced fuel efficiency, or even difficulty starting the engine. In severe cases, a failing crankshaft can lead to complete engine seizure, leaving you stranded on the side of the road. Installation and Maintenance Considerations

Installing a new crankshaft is a complex and labor-intensive process that should ideally be performed by a qualified mechanic. It requires specialized tools and knowledge, as well as meticulous attention to detail. Before installing the new crankshaft, the engine block must be thoroughly cleaned and inspected for any damage. The crankshaft bearings must also be carefully inspected and replaced if necessary. The crankshaft must be properly lubricated and torqued to the manufacturer's specifications to ensure proper operation and prevent premature wear. Post-installation, regular oil changes are crucial to maintaining the crankshaft's health. Using high-quality engine oil and following the manufacturer's recommended oil change intervals will help to lubricate the crankshaft bearings and prevent excessive wear. Furthermore, avoiding aggressive driving habits, such as frequent high-RPM operation and sudden acceleration, can help to prolong the crankshaft's lifespan.

Crankshaft Replacement: Is it Time for an Upgrade?

When faced with the need to replace your Hyundai VVT 1.6 engine's crankshaft (OEM 23110-26600/26100), it’s a great opportunity to consider an upgrade, especially if you plan to boost your engine's performance. If you are simply restoring the engine to its original state, a standard OEM replacement is an obvious choice. But, if you're aiming for increased horsepower or torque, a forged crankshaft is the way to go. Forged crankshafts are made from a single piece of metal that has been compressed and shaped under extreme pressure, making them significantly stronger and more durable than cast crankshafts. This added strength allows them to withstand the higher stresses and strains associated with high-performance engines. However, they are more expensive than standard OEM replacements.
